Linux系统下数据库高效运行优化方案
发布时间:2026-03-24 14:48:27 所属栏目:Linux 来源:DaWei
导读:AI设计的框架图,仅供参考 在Linux系统下,数据库的高效运行依赖于多个方面的优化。操作系统本身的配置对数据库性能有直接影响。例如,调整内核参数如文件描述符限制、内存分配策略以及I/O调度器,可以显著提升数
|
AI设计的框架图,仅供参考 在Linux系统下,数据库的高效运行依赖于多个方面的优化。操作系统本身的配置对数据库性能有直接影响。例如,调整内核参数如文件描述符限制、内存分配策略以及I/O调度器,可以显著提升数据库的响应速度和吞吐量。磁盘I/O是数据库性能的关键瓶颈之一。使用SSD代替传统HDD能够大幅提高读写速度,同时合理规划磁盘分区和RAID配置也能增强数据存取效率。定期清理日志文件和优化数据库表结构,有助于减少不必要的I/O操作。 内存管理同样不可忽视。Linux系统通过页缓存机制提升数据访问速度,但需要根据数据库的工作负载调整相关参数,如vm.swappiness,以避免频繁的内存交换影响性能。合理设置数据库的缓存区大小,能有效减少磁盘访问次数。 网络配置也会影响数据库的性能表现。确保数据库服务器与客户端之间的网络连接稳定且延迟低,可以通过调整TCP参数、使用高效的协议栈或部署负载均衡来实现。开启数据库的连接池功能,可以减少频繁建立和销毁连接带来的开销。 监控和分析工具是持续优化的基础。利用如top、iostat、vmstat等系统工具,结合数据库自带的性能分析功能,可以及时发现瓶颈并进行针对性优化。定期审查慢查询日志,并对频繁执行的SQL语句进行索引优化,也是保持数据库高效运行的重要手段。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
推荐文章
站长推荐

